Tarzan to stay at home instead of Grafton

Sunday 8 July 2018, 12:44pm

Speedster Tarzan is likely to miss the James Kirby Quality at Grafton to tackle a race on his favoured home track of Caloundra.

Trainer Stuart Kendrick had planned to take Tarzan to Grafton on Thursday for the Kirby but was bemused when the gelding was given 61.5 kg.

"They haven't missed him at the weights. There is a 1000-metre race at Caloundra on Saturday worth more money," Kendrick said.

"We all know how good Tarzan is at Caloundra and at 1000 metres so it is very tempting."

Tarzan was second behind Ringo's A Rockstar at Caloundra two weeks ago which took his record at the track and distance to 11 starts for seven wins and three seconds.

"He was attacked by a lightly weighted horse for the lead so it was a very good effort," Kendrick said.

"I will have a look at the likely Caloundra race field after nominations and make up my mind. But at this stage we will probably stay home."

Tarzan holds the course record for 1000m at Caloundra at 56.1 seconds but is unlikely to get near that on Saturday with soft conditions already predicted.

Ringo's A Rockstar is also likely to be a rival again.
